Larger Health Clubs And Community Fitness Centers

Large clubs like the Ohio State Health and Fitness Center New Albany provide a wide range of facilities. They include pools, numerous weekly classes, and extensive machine selections. Members can access lap and warm-water pools, personalized wellness plans, and access to on-site registered dietitians who work alongside trainers. This integrated approach is well suited to those seeking both fitness and medical support in one place.

Infrared Workouts And Specialty Fitness Studios

Focused studios including Power in Motion New Albany center around infrared saunas and short, intense sessions. Options include 30-minute isometric classes, Pilates, barre, and 15-minute HIIT bursts. These studios often include technology for tracking progress and offer community programs like TrainingTRAX and DietTRAX. For those looking for efficient workouts with round-the-clock access, New Albany’s fitness studios are worth considering.

Small Group And Coaching-Focused Gyms

Independent gyms like 413 Fit Club emphasize small groups and personalized coaching. They offer free assessments, custom programs, and regular check-ins for accountability. Members value the coaching, meal-prep advice, and the close-knit community atmosphere. If you want a more intimate setting with trainer guidance, New Albany’s small gyms can support consistent progress and quicker improvements.

Wide Weekly Class Schedules

Community centers and larger health clubs in New Albany offer extensive weekly schedules. These include classes in cardio, strength, aquatics, yoga, pilates, and barre, available at various times. This flexibility helps members work classes into packed schedules.

Ohio State Health and Fitness Center in New Albany hosts dozens of instructor-led sessions weekly. These sessions are held at predictable times, making it easier to establish a routine and monitor progress.

Limited-Capacity Boutique Classes

Specialty fitness spaces in New Albany focus on smaller groups for more personalized attention and intensity. Infrared classes, for example, are kept intentionally small, aiding in mastering technique and maintaining a steady pace.

Power in Motion New Albany relies on capped sessions for a mix of isometric and dynamic exercises, lasting from 15 to 30 minutes. The small group sizes let instructors refine the form and intensity in real-time.
